Ticket: Fleetwise driver-assignment heuristic double-books drivers near zone boundaries. Repro: two pending jobs within 400m of the Marrowfield zone edge; heuristic assigns the same driver to both before the lock commits. Impact: cancellations spike during evening peak. Mitigation: pin assignment to single-zone mode via feature flag. Fix candidate is in review. Verify against the staging build identified by the token below.

trace token, hahif-tadug: htk31_779e5b7e76a72da695288ece2437595

### Release Checklist — Item 7: Turnstile Counter Verification

Before signing off the Pellgate counter release for Marrowfield Stadium, run the full rotation test suite on at least two physical units, not just the simulator. Confirm that entry counts match the optical backup sensor within a tolerance of one per thousand rotations. Record the firmware version shown on the unit display and compare it against the release manifest. If anything disagrees, stop and escalate to the Pellgate lead. The build token to verify against is printed below.

pipeline stamp: htk9_ce63042d9

# Heads-up for the eng sync: we're swapping the homegrown job queue
# (old "taskbarn" module) for Conveyly. Less duct tape, actual retries,
# and we can finally delete the cron hack. Workers read jobs straight
# from the shared queue table for now. Conveyly reaches that table
# through the connection string below.

primary connection of tajeg-tajop = postgresql://julax_svc:DI@db-e7f3.kelvidyn.corp:5432/rusdor

Subject: DR drill — audit-log viewer restore step

Hi,

During tomorrow's disaster-recovery drill, the Ledgerscope audit-log viewer will be rebuilt from snapshots in the standby cluster. As release manager, you'll verify the restored viewer shows the last 30 days of entries. To decrypt the snapshot archive, use the recovery passphrase below.

recovery phrase for fawif-tajeg: norael-aldmir-casir-brivan-ulaion